Web83.01 Unwritten lease tenancy at will; duration. — Any lease of lands and tenements, or either, made shall be deemed and held to be a tenancy at will unless it shall be in writing signed by the lessor. WebWatch on. In Florida, a landlord has the legal right to terminate a month-to-month lease without cause by providing a 15-day notice to the tenant. The notice must be in writing, and it should clearly state the termination date. WHAT IF I LIVE IN PUBLIC HOUSING, HAVE A SECTION 8 VOUCHER, LIVE … dab active driver m/t 1.0 manualWebAug 15, 2024 · Florida law varies depending on if the tenant is “month to month” [no lease] or currently under a lease agreement. If the tenancy is from month to month, a landlord may not terminate it by giving less than 15-days’ notice (see Section 83.57 of Florida Residential Landlord Tenant Act).
